He discovered present-day Puerto Rico and Florida.
Ponce de leon heard of a magical fountain that sprouted waters that made you young again(fountain of youth). So he set sail to the island.
When he made it to the island ,he named it Florida, after the catholic feast day called Easter of Flowers or Pascua Florida in Spanish. He never realized he discovered a new continent.
When he returned to Florida in 1521,he started a settlement with 200 men along with horses, cattle and seeds to plant.
The American Indians were not happy with them for invading territory so they attacked. Ponce de Leon was struck by an arrow and while wounded, sailed to Cuba and died. His Expodtions ended in 1521.
